The Ryobi 12087L Tile Saw is a powerful and versatile tool designed for professional and DIY tile cutting tasks. With a cutting capacity of up to 12 inches in diameter and a maximum depth of 3-5/8 inches, this tile saw is capable of handling a wide variety of tile materials, including 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one.
The saw features a powerful 15-amp motor that delivers 5,000 RPM, ensuring smooth and precise cuts every time. The saw also includes a water-filled diamond blade that helps to reduce dust and prevent blade overheating, making it easier to work in enclosed spaces and improve the overall cutting experience.
The Ryobi 12087L Tile Saw is equipped with a large, easy-to-read digital readout that allows for accurate and easy adjustments to the miter angle, ensuring that your cuts are square and accurate. The saw also includes a quick-release guide fence that allows for easy blade changes and adjustments, saving you time and effort in the field.
The saw is also designed with portability in mind, featuring a foldable stand that makes it easy to transport and store. The saw also includes a convenient cord wrap system that keeps the cord tidy and out of the way, reducing the risk of accidents and improving overall safety.
